Disturbing Drawings

My nephew is 9 years old and he has been drawing some disturbing pictures lately. In these pictures he has drawn himself being killed such as being hanged and so forth. He has been drawing these pictures in school and has been reported by the teacher. His parent are blowing it off even though the school has reccomended counseling. Should this just be ignored or should I take steps to get him the counseling needed and if so how do I go about it since the parents refuse? There are some underlying issues with his mother that may be the reason he is acting this way, but he will not say because he is terrified of his mother.

Have you talked with your nephew's school counselor?  Most school systems have them available and are qualified to work with the child at school for most situations.

It sounds to me he may have issues or fears of being hurt.  My 12 yr. old grandson was drawing pics of his abuse for several years prior to it coming to light.

I hope you can get the help for him he needs.

Have you contacted Childrens Services to investigate any abuse?

Also, try to spend as much quality time alone with him and build his confidence that you will protect him and he just might confide in you what is really going on once he feels safe.
